Mimics Enlight CMF is a workflow-based software to plan the surgical treatment of cranio-maxillofacial procedures. First, users create 3D anatomical models by importing, visualizing, and segmenting medical images of the patient. Next, they plan the surgery with visualization and measurement tools. Last, the user designs personalized occlusal splints to transfer the plan to the operating room. The created models can be exported for 3D printing purposes. Materialise is a dynamic, international high-tech company, founded in 1990 and headquartered in Belgium, with over 2,300 employees worldwide. Materialise’s mission is to innovate for a better and healthier world through its software and hardware infrastructure and in-depth knowledge of additive manufacturing (also known as 3D printing). Our customers are in diverse industries, such as automotive, aerospace, medical, research, and academia.
